This patch makes ior_hard_reg_conflicts take a const_hard_reg_set rather than a pointer, so that it can be passed a temporary object in later patches.
2019-09-09 Richard Sandiford <richard.sandif...@arm.com> gcc/ * ira-int.h (ior_hard_reg_conflicts): Take a const_hard_reg_set instead of a HARD_REG_SET *. * ira-build.c (ior_hard_reg_conflicts): Likewise. (ira_build): Update call accordingly. * ira-emit.c (add_range_and_copies_from_move_list): Likewise.
